8 clinics specializing in Vascular surgery providing treatment of Carotid body paraganglioma Carotid body paraganglioma is a rare tumor arising from cells in the carotid body, a small structure near the carotid artery. It can cause neck swelling, high blood pressure, and requires surgical removal or radiation therapy for treatment. disease in Czech Republic.
